ABSTRACT:
A liquid hydrocarbon and an insoluble displacing fluid are passed through a core sample from a subsurface formation. The two-phase effluent flow out of the core sample is collected in a container where the two phases separate into an overlying fluid phase and an underlying fluid phase and the volumes of each phase are measured as an indication of the permeability of the core sample. Such volumes are measured by placing fluid level detectors in the container and detecting the movements of the air-fluid interface of the top of the overlying fluid phase and the fluid-fluid interface between the two phases as the fluid is drained from the container.
